A CONGESTION CONTROL APPROACH BASED ON PREDICTIVE MODEL IN DELAY NETWORK

To overcome the disadvantage influence of time delay term on the TCP/AQM control system model, the paper proposed that a new AQM algorithm called SPI (Proportional Integral control based on Smith predictor), which combined Smith predictor and Dahlin algorithm. By moving the time delay term to the outside of control loop, SPI can eliminate the influence of time delay on the system performance, and reduce the number of the tuning parameters. The result of simulation shows that the presented SPI controller can effectively avoid network congestion, improve the system stability, and have a good performance in respect to robustness to variation of system parameters.
